Going on a job interview is stressful enough without worrying that you don't have a suit. SuitsForOthers.com allows people to Donate their unwanted business clothes to those who need them - for free!

Last Thursday, CNN aired a news story about Kreg Graham, a Job Seeker who had nothing to wear to his job interview so placed an ad on Facebook asking for help. People responded immediately, sending suits, clothes and even money to help him out. After seeing this story, Charlie Trig, owner of Trig Web Design (www.trigwebdesign.com) created a free website called SuitsForOthers.com, a website that allows people to post their unwanted business clothing for others that need them.

The website is a powerful web application that blends social networking software with a customize ad posting system. Members can create classified ads of suits and other business items, or even donate money to help the cause. With so many people looking for a job, a service like this is desperately needed; and gives hope to those who have lost their jobs to this economical mess we find oursleves in.
